Wayne Perry
3/13/1951 - 5/22/2026
Obituary For Wayne Perry
Wayne Perry born in Covington, Kentucky, March 13, 1951 died March 22, 2026 after a long illness.
He is survived by his best friend and wife of fifty years, Jeannie. He was a loving father and grandfather to his daughter Nicole King (Tyler) and grandchildren James and Riley King. Brothers Ron, Larry, Charlie and Bob, several nieces and nephews and sister-in-law Kay Robinson also survive him.
Wayne was preceded in death by parents, Albert and Ruth, and sister Ruth Ann Hardtke.
Wayne loved a good adventure! He was a barge deckhand one summer in high school going down the Ohio and Mississippi Rivers. He spent time hitchhiking through France in college.
He joined the Navy in 1974. Guam was his only tour. He and Jeannie enjoyed traveling to different countries in Asia. After the service he worked for Sanders Associates (later Raytheon) where he learned and taught the Patriot Missile Guidance System to the German Air Force and later at Fort Bliss in El Paso, Texas.
Wayne spent the next twenty-five years working first for Ford and later Lear Corporation. While with Lear, Wayne and family were transferred to Portugal coming back to the U.S. (Michigan) in time for Y2K.
After retirement they settled in The Villages, Florida. Wayne enjoyed LOTS of golf and hosting family and friends. They traveled to Michigan to see the grandchildren until it became too difficult for Wayne.
He was an honest and kind man. Generous with his love and respect. Wayne, you will be missed.
